我想为我的数据输出一个扩展Proc Means
。标准是N, Min, Max, Std mean
但我也需要中位数。
我有很多变量,所以我不想在输出 out= 语句(如median(var1)=var1_median
等)之后单独指定每个变量。
以下内容不起作用,只是给我标准输出:
proc means data=have n mean median std;
output out= want_means (drop=_type_ _freq_);
run;
这个也不起作用:
proc means data=have n mean median std;
var volume price [xyz variables];
output out= want_means (drop=_type_ _freq_);
run;
我现在使用以下对我有用的(请注意,我必须转置它才能进行观察而不是 X 变量......
proc means data=have;
output out= want(drop=_type_ _freq_)
n= mean= median= std= /autoname ;
run;
proc transpose data=want
out=want; run;